Argentine Stars Hit Back at Rami’s Criticism of World Cup Goalkeeper Martinez

Argentine players like Angel Di Maria and Leandro Paredes reacted to the comments of French player of Moroccan origin Adil Rami on Argentine goalkeeper Emiliano Martinez.
In the face of Emiliano Martinez’s provocations after Argentina’s triumph at the 2022 Qatar World Cup, Adil Rami had, in Instagram stories, described the Argentine goalkeeper as "the biggest FD* in the world of football. The most hated man." "[...] Kylian Mbappé traumatizes them so much that they celebrate their victory against our prodigy more than their World Cup," the former 2018 world champion had added.
As reported by the newspaper Olé on its Instagram account with the comment: "It continues to hurt in France." This prompted strong reactions from Argentine players. "El Dibu (Martinez’s nickname, editor’s note) best goalkeeper in the world. Go cry elsewhere," comments Angel Di Maria. "Stop crying Rami," writes his teammate Leandro Paredes. "Lol, go away Rami," German Pezzella, also a world champion, let go.
